| Ok here's the deal the person had a 500.00 gift card, and she had 5 auctions, only 1 auction winner would get the gift card, and the others would get a 'prize of cents on up to 20.00. The way the auction was worded was that you were bidding on an ENVELOPE, that was numbered 1-5, and only one of the auctions had teh actual gift card, no amounts were the same, and all amounts outside of the gift card were a mystery. Do you think people should be allowed to run auctions like this, because while they do not call it a lottery or a sweepstakes that's basically what you are winning, the money if you don't get the gift card is deposited in your PayPal account, and you don't even get a tangible envelope with the money in it. In order to win the gift card you would have to bid on all 5 auctions and win them all. So are aucitons like this right? Mooch | | | | | |
